Поделиться через


phoneAuthenticationMethod: disableSmsSignIn

Пространство имен: microsoft.graph

Отключите вход в SMS для существующего mobile номера телефона, зарегистрированного для пользователя. Этот номер больше не будет доступен для входа в SMS, что может помешать входу пользователя.

Этот API доступен в следующих национальных облачных развертываниях.

Глобальная служба Правительство США L4 Правительство США L5 (DOD) Китай управляется 21Vianet

Разрешения

Для вызова этого API требуется одно из следующих разрешений. Дополнительные сведения, включая сведения о том, как выбрать разрешения, см. в статье Разрешения.

Разрешения, действующие на себя

Тип разрешения Разрешения с наименьшими привилегиями Более высокие привилегированные разрешения
Делегированные (рабочая или учебная учетная запись) UserAuthenticationMethod.ReadWrite UserAuthenticationMethod.ReadWrite.All
Делегированные (личная учетная запись Майкрософт) Не поддерживается. Не поддерживается.
Для приложений Не поддерживается. Не поддерживается.

Разрешения, действующие для других пользователей

Тип разрешения Разрешения с наименьшими привилегиями Более высокие привилегированные разрешения
Делегированные (рабочая или учебная учетная запись) UserAuthenticationMethod.ReadWrite.All Недоступно.
Делегированные (личная учетная запись Майкрософт) Не поддерживается. Не поддерживается.
Приложение UserAuthenticationMethod.ReadWrite.All Недоступно.

Важно!

В делегированных сценариях с рабочими или учебными учетными записями, в которых пользователь, выполнив вход, работает с другим пользователем, ему должна быть назначена поддерживаемая роль Microsoft Entra или настраиваемая роль с разрешением поддерживаемой роли. Для этой операции поддерживаются следующие роли с наименьшими привилегиями.

  • Администратор проверки подлинности
  • Привилегированный администратор проверки подлинности

HTTP-запрос

Отключите вход в SMS для собственного метода проверки подлинности на мобильном телефоне.

POST /me/authentication/phoneMethods/{mobilePhoneMethodId}/disableSmsSignIn

Отключите вход в SMS для метода проверки подлинности на мобильном телефоне или с помощью другого пользователя.

POST /users/{id | userPrincipalName}/authentication/phoneMethods/{mobilePhoneMethodId}/disableSmsSignIn

Значение mobilePhoneMethodId для mobile phoneType равно 3179e48a-750b-4051-897c-87b9720928f7.

Заголовки запросов

Имя Описание
Авторизация Bearer {token}. Обязательно. Дополнительные сведения о проверке подлинности и авторизации.

Текст запроса

Не указывайте текст запроса для этого метода.

Отклик

В случае успешного выполнения этот метод возвращает код отклика 204 No Content. Он не возвращает ничего в теле ответа.

Примеры

В приведенном ниже примере показано, как вызывать этот API.

Запрос

Ниже показан пример запроса.

POST https://graph.microsoft.com/v1.0/me/authentication/phoneMethods/3179e48a-750b-4051-897c-87b9720928f7/disableSmsSignIn

Отклик

Ниже приводится пример отклика.

HTTP/1.1 204 No Content